细胞核增殖抗原蛋白在胃癌组织的表达及其临床意义 被引量:1

Expression and clinical implication of proliferation cell nuclear antigen protein in gastric cancer

摘要 目的观察细胞核增殖抗原(Ki-67)蛋白在胃癌组织及癌旁正常组织中的表达,分析其临床病理特征。方法收集胃腺癌组织及其配对癌旁组织170例,应用免疫组织化学方法测定Ki-67的表达,分析其与临床病理特征的关系。结果Ki-67在胃腺癌中表达增高,高表达率为64.10%(109/170),高于癌旁组织的35.90%(61/170)。经Wileoxon检验,表达差异有统计学意义(Z=-9.522,P=0.000)。胃腺癌组织中Ki-67的高表达与患者的年龄(P=0.595)、性别(P=0.824)、分化类型(P=0.542)、TNM分期(P=0.073)、远处转移(P=0.530)、浸润深度(P=0.150)、肿瘤大小(P=0.143)及组织类型(P=0.854)无明显相关,但与患者的5年生存期(P=0.000)和淋巴结转移(P=0.006)明显相关。结论Ki-67的高表达可能与胃癌的发生发展明显相关。 Objective To investigate the expression level and the clinical significance of prolifera- tion cell nuclear antigen ( Ki - 67 ) in gastric adenocarcinomas ( GA ) tissues and paired non - neoplastic tissues. Methods The express of Ki - 67 in 170 paired of gastric cancer and corresponding adjacent tis- sues was detected by immunohistochemistry, and the relationship of Ki - 67 level with clinicopathogical fac- tors was explored. Results The positive expression of Ki - 67 in cancer tissues was 64. 10% (109/170) , significantly higher than 35.90% (61/170) in non - neoplastic tissues ( P = 0. 000, the Wileoxon test). The up - expression of Ki - 67 was not significantly correlated with patients' age ( P = 0. 595 ) , sex ( P = 0. 824) , differentiation grade (P =0. 542), TNM stage (P =0. 073), distant metastasis(P =0. 530), the depth of invasion ( P = 0. 150 ), tumor size ( P = 0. 143 ) and tissue type ( P = 0. 854), but obvious related with 5 - years survival of patients ( P = 0. 000 ) and lymphnode metastasis ( P = 0. 006 ). Conclusion Ki - 67 may play important roles in the development and progression of gastric carcinoma.
